Australia’s SEA 1000 Attack-class future submarine programme was planned to introduce a class of 12 new SSKs built in Australia to replace the Royal Australian Navy’s (RAN’s) existing fleet of six Collins-class submarines and expand its sub-surface capability. It was intended as one of the largest and most ambitious defence procurement projects ever undertaken in Australia and posed a significant amount of risk. In September 2021, Australia cancelled the programme for 12 new SSKs and instead is to begin a new
programme for at least eight new SSNs with the support of the US and the UK under the trilateral ‘next-generation partnership’ AUKUS security pact.
